bgp: add code to handle RD 0:0 at the head of nexthop network address in MP_REACH_NLRI path attribute

The second is patch to add or skip RD 0:0 label for the next_hop address in MP_REACH_NLRI attribute.

According to RFC, next_hop address seems to be required to contain RD of 0 when advertise VPN prefix.
This is defined in RFC 4659(3.2.1.1.  BGP Speaker Requesting IPv6 Transport) for VPN-IPv6
and in RFC 4364(4.3.2.  Route Distribution Among PEs by BGP) for VPN-IPv4.
